Skip to content
Prev Previous commit
Next Next commit
fix import
  • Loading branch information
HyukjinKwon committed Apr 3, 2024
commit ea9e66c164dac33b216f22c64e0796921777b25d
3 changes: 2 additions & 1 deletion python/pyspark/sql/pandas/map_ops.py
Original file line number Diff line number Diff line change
Expand Up @@ -23,6 +23,7 @@
from pyspark.sql.types import StructType

if TYPE_CHECKING:
from py4j.java_gateway import JavaObject
from pyspark.sql.dataframe import DataFrame
from pyspark.sql.pandas._typing import PandasMapIterFunction, ArrowMapIterFunction

Expand Down Expand Up @@ -250,7 +251,7 @@ def mapInArrow(

def _build_java_profile(
self, profile: Optional[ResourceProfile] = None
) -> Optional[JavaObject]:
) -> Optional["JavaObject"]:
"""Build the java ResourceProfile based on PySpark ResourceProfile"""
from pyspark.sql import DataFrame

Expand Down